How to install DRLF series large flow return oil filter

The DRLF series high-flow return oil filter is primarily installed in the return oil line of a hydraulic system. Its function is to filter out impurities such as metal powder and rubber particles produced by the wear of various components in the oil, thereby maintaining the cleanliness of the oil flowing back into the oil tank. Below is a detailed explanation of the installation and operation steps for the DRLF series high-flow return oil filter:

Installation Steps

Determine the Installation Location: Based on the layout of the hydraulic system and actual requirements, determine the installation location of the filter. Generally, the filter should be directly installed on the return oil line, with consideration for ease of subsequent maintenance and filter element replacement.

Inspect the Installation Environment: Ensure that the installation location is free of oil contamination, moisture, and impurities, and that environmental factors such as temperature and humidity meet the operational requirements of the filter.

Connect the Flange: Use a flange connection to link the filter to the return oil line. Ensure that the flange connection is tight to prevent oil leakage.

Check the Differential Pressure Transmitter and Bypass Valve: During installation, ensure that the differential pressure transmitter and bypass valve are functioning normally. The differential pressure transmitter monitors the clogging of the filter element, while the bypass valve protects the system when the filter element is clogged.

Operation Steps

Start the Hydraulic System: After confirming that the filter is installed correctly, start the hydraulic system and observe the filter's operating status.

Monitor the Differential Pressure Transmitter: During the operation of the hydraulic system, regularly monitor the indications of the differential pressure transmitter. When the filter element becomes clogged and the differential pressure between the inlet and outlet reaches 0.35 MPa, the transmitter will send a signal. At this point, promptly shut down the system and replace the filter element.

Replace the Filter Element: Turn off the hydraulic system, disassemble the filter according to the instructions, remove the old filter element, and replace it with a new one. Ensure that the model and specifications of the new filter element match those of the old one.

Restart the Hydraulic System: After replacing the filter element, restart the hydraulic system and observe the filter's operating status again. Ensure that the filter is functioning properly and there is no oil leakage.

Precautions

Select Appropriate Filter Elements: Based on the actual operational requirements of the hydraulic system, select suitable filter element models and specifications. Ensure that the filter element's filtration accuracy, oil flow capacity, and dirt holding capacity meet the system requirements.

Regular Inspections and Maintenance: Regularly inspect and maintain the filter, including cleaning the filter element, checking the functionality of the differential pressure transmitter and bypass valve, etc. Ensure that the filter's performance and safety are always in good condition.

Observe Safe Operating Procedures: During installation and use, adhere to safe operating procedures to avoid accidents.
